**POSITION INFORMATION**: This will be a Full-time, Temporary position to fill in at the United States Coast Guard Academy for approximately 12 weeks while our current Athletic Trainer is on Leave of Absence. The United States Coast Guard Academy (USCGA) is one of four Armed Forces Academies of the United States. The Academy’s four-year college-level training and education fulfills mission needs by providing commissioned officers for the United States Coast Guard (USCG). USCGA provides a rigorous undergraduate program, from which cadets graduate with a Bachelor of Science degree and a commission as an Ensign in the USCG. USCGA is located in New London, CT. USCGA supports an NCAA Division III athletic program that includes 25 sports and 4 four-chartered clubs with over 600 student-athletes. USCGA competes in the New England Women’s and Men’s Athletic Conferences.

**RESPONSIBILITIES**:

- Athletic Trainers support the USCGA’s Health and Physical Education (HPE) curriculum, varsity teams, and club sports
- Athletic Trainers will provide a full range of services including:

- Performing injury prevention and mitigation
- Rehabilitation services
- Athletic performance optimization for cadets during training
- HPE programming
- Onsite and offsite competitions and practice events
- Perform diagnostic examinations and deliver treatments to cadet patients who have suffered an injury or with any condition that is limiting athletic performance
- Develop comprehensive treatment plans when indicated to include preventive services and mandated medical follow-up instructions
- Prepare timely treatment records and reports documenting procedures performed and care provided
- Refer patients to their primary care manager when indicated
- Furnish consultation and reports as well as services specialized to meet the needs of cadets
- Advise and consult with physical therapists, medical officers, and training division staff (when necessary) through the Head Trainer
- Manage and direct treatments of sports injuries to include but not limited to cryocuff, moist heat packs, ultrasound, hydrotherapy, and electrical stimulation
- Provide preventive taping and use of numerous protective orthotic devices
- Provide evaluation, prevention, and treatment to include teaching patients progressive therapeutic exercises to restore the patient to pre-injury status
- Support concussion protocols and baseline testing for concussion protocols
- From time to time perform administrative, storekeeping, and cleaning tasks within the work area, as necessary
- Provide consultations to patients in a virtual format when restrictions prevent in-person interactions
- Other duties as assigned

**QUALIFICATIONS**:

- Bachelor’s Degree in Sports Medicine from an accredited College or University, with a minimum of one year experience as an Athletic Trainer
- A current unrestricted license to practice Athletic Trainer Services in Connecticut
- Shall maintain current certification as required for membership in the National Athletic Trainers Association (NATA)
- Current malpractice insurance in the amount of not less than one million ($1,000,000.00) dollars per occurrence
- Have and maintain certification in Basic Cardiac Life Support (BLS) for the Health Care Provider by the American Heart Association (AHA), American Red Cross (ARC), American Safety & Health Institute (ASHI), or the American College of Emergency Physicians (ACEP)
- “No adverse information on file” with the National Practitioners Data Bank (NPDB)
- The Athletic Trainer shall be physically capable of performing all athletic training services
